Staff Scheduling Best Practices for Sheboygan Gyms

Effective staff scheduling is crucial for maintaining operational excellence in Sheboygan fitness facilities. Creating schedules that balance business needs with employee preferences leads to better retention and service quality. This becomes especially important in Sheboygan’s tight labor market, where finding and keeping qualified fitness professionals can be challenging for small gym businesses.

  • Advance Schedule Publishing: Provide staff schedules at least two weeks in advance to allow employees to plan their personal lives, particularly important for accommodating Wisconsin’s seasonal activities.
  • Consistent Shift Patterns: When possible, maintain regular schedules that employees can rely on, making exceptions for special events or seasonal adjustments.
  • Employee Preference Consideration: Collect and incorporate staff availability and preferences into scheduling decisions to improve satisfaction and reduce turnover.
  • Fair Distribution of Premium Times: Rotate desirable shifts (like prime weekday evenings) and less desirable ones (early mornings or weekends) equitably among staff.
  • Cross-Training Opportunities: Schedule staff across different roles when appropriate to build skills and provide backup coverage for absences.

2. How can I ensure my scheduling system accommodates Sheboygan’s seasonal fitness patterns?

Look for scheduling software with flexible capacity management and seasonal template capabilities. This allows you to adjust class offerings, staffing levels, and facility hours based on predictable seasonal patterns in Sheboygan, such as higher indoor gym usage during winter months and reduced attendance during summer when outdoor activities are popular. The system should allow you to create and save multiple schedule templates that can be easily deployed as seasons change, while providing tools to analyze year-over-year trends for continuous refinement of your seasonal planning.

3. What’s the best way to transition from manual scheduling to an automated system without disrupting operations?

Implement a phased approach to minimize disruption. Begin by selecting a scheduling system with good implementation support like those offering dedicated training. Start with internal staff scheduling before introducing member-facing features. Run parallel systems (old and new) for a short transition period while providing comprehensive training for all users. Communicate clearly with both staff and members about the upcoming changes, highlighting the benefits they’ll experience. Choose a slower business period for the final transition, and have contingency plans ready to address any issues that arise during implementation.
